What kind of metamorphosis roaches have

Respuesta :

SmartJosh
SmartJosh SmartJosh
  • 31-01-2024

Answer:

Incomplete metamorphosis

Explanation:

Immature roaches look pretty much like adult roaches, except they don't have wings yet. As they grow the molt (shed their whole skin at once) several times. After the last molt, they roach has wings and can reproduce.
